银河微电上半年增收不增利,银江投资减持套现超1亿元
2 1 Shi Ji Jing Ji Bao Dao· 2025-09-05 03:16
Core Insights - Galaxy Microelectronics (688689.SH) reported a revenue of 477 million yuan for the first half of 2025, marking a year-on-year increase of 14.54% [1] - The net profit attributable to shareholders decreased to 27.22 million yuan, a decline of 21.87% year-on-year, while the net profit excluding non-recurring gains and losses fell by 19.91% to 17.69 million yuan [1] Revenue and Profit Analysis - The company maintained a growth trajectory in revenue, achieving 477 million yuan in the first half of 2025, which is a 14.54% increase compared to the previous year [1] - However, the net profit attributable to shareholders saw a significant decline of 21.87%, primarily due to increased competition and strategic adjustments leading to higher costs [1] Cost and Investment Factors - The profit decline is attributed to two main factors: intense external market competition affecting product pricing and profit margins, and internal strategic adjustments resulting in increased costs [1] - The company has made new investments in the optoelectronic devices and IGBT module sectors, including equipment purchases and personnel increases, which have led to a significant rise in fixed costs [1] Cash Flow and Operational Impact - The new projects are still in the capacity ramp-up phase and have not yet achieved economies of scale, which has directly impacted profit margins due to high cost allocation [1] - Additionally, the expansion in sales scale has resulted in increased employee compensation and higher cash payments for goods, leading to a 34.43% year-on-year decline in net cash flow from operating activities [1] Shareholder Activity - The Changzhou Yinjian Investment Management Center (Limited Partnership) conducted a reduction in holdings from March to June, cumulatively reducing 4.41 million shares, amounting to approximately 108 million yuan [1] - The company's chairman, Yang Senmao, serves as the executive partner of Yinjian Investment [1]
